Terminal Connections
2 Wire
Terminal 1 + ve: Direct Current (DC) input (11-30VDC)
Terminal 2 - ve: Current Output (4-20mA)
Loop Resistance
For two wire operation the maximum cable resistance allowable can be calculated
from the graph below. For example if an
IMP+
IMP+
IMP+
IMP+
were supplied from 24v connected
as a 2 wire unit (4-20mA only), the maximum total cable resistance is 590 ohms,
for a typical 77 ohm /km cable this would mean a maximum cable length of
590/77 = 7.6km, remember this total cable resistance, so this figure has to be
divided by 2 to give 3.8km max distance.
